Transforming The Theory Of Constraints To The Agent-Based Development And Implementation Model For Today’s AI

Procurement Insights

The core principle of TOC is that every system has at least one constraint that determines its overall output, and by optimizing that constraint, significant improvements can be achieved. Example: If a slow approval process is the constraint in procurement, optimizing workflows, reducing paperwork, or automating approvals can help.
